Earlier this year we filed our first report about the collaboration between Porsche and Dynamiq that resulted in the first luxury motor yacht to carry the legendary Porsche brand, GTT 115.

The GTT 115 came on the heels of several other luxury automakers that have been jumping into the design and build of yachts and superyachts. Prior to the introduction of the Porsche yacht, back in 2016 we reported on the 46 feet long, Arrow 460 Granturismo, the first luxury yacht designed and built by Mercedes-Benz, and the AM37, which was built by Quintessence Yachts in conjunction with Aston Martin. So far in 2017, in addition to the GTT 115, we introduced you to the Lexus Sport Yacht, and the Niniette 66, a collaboration between Palmer Johnson and Bugatti.

These kinds of collaborations between luxury yacht makers and luxury car makers, are redefining the term “superyacht,” to not necessarily only mean “super” in size, but super in terms of performance, style and luxury.

The “GTT” in the GTT 115, stands for Grand Turismo Transatlantic. Known for such iconic sports cars as the Porsche 911 and Boxster, the GTT 115 is the German auto maker’s first foray into the superyacht market.  In development for most of this year, a first look at the highly anticipated collaboration between Dynamiq and Porches has become available. Like the previews of a blockbuster movie, the makers of the extraordinary unique luxury yacht have released a video “trailer,” to introduce the world to the GTT 115.

The hybrid superyacht made her debut at the recent Monaco Yacht Show. Speaking at the show, Dynamiq CEO, Sergei Dobroserdov, hailed the GTT 115 as “the culmination of a long process of design and development to introduce a new kind of superyacht to the market”.

The Porsche superyacht will sell for approximately 10.3 million dollars. Expected to appeal to a very exclusive clientele, there will only be seven ever built, all of which have already been spoken for.

Porsche’s Studio FA, the design group that was responsible for creating Porsche sunglasses, watches and other branded luxury items, took charge of the boat’s exterior styling, mimicking the body shapes that have made Porsche’s cars instantly recognizable the world over. Roland Heiler, CEO of Studio F.A. Porsche, added, “Taking the spirit of high-performance sportscar styling to the high seas, the Dynamiq GTT 115 is designed to appeal to car lovers and forward-thinking yacht owners who appreciate the advantages of speed, style and our philosophy of intelligent performance.”

Other Features of the Porsche GTT 115 Superyacht

The sleek and sexy lines of the GTT 115, are definitely Porsche inspired, however, its interiors, rather than being sports car sparse, are every inch superyacht luxury.  Fitted with seven-foot-high ceilings on both decks, the spacious cabins are lined with carbon fiber and marble detailing throughout, with furniture and throw-pillows finished with the same material as the seats in a Porsche 911R. The GTT 115 is an all-aluminum yacht, and features an exclusive stabilization system, with a round-bilge hull, finished in Rhodium silver metallic paint.

The boat has been designed to cater for a maximum of 12 people – six passengers and six crew members. She runs on two MAN diesel engines with a combined 12,594 horsepower, and also runs as a hybrid using two 20.8 kW electric motors.

Owing to a legacy that built its reputation on the Autobahn, at full tilt, the GTT 115 Hybrid can reach a top speed of over 21 knots, when operating on the diesel engines alone.

Dynamiq has also said they plan on creating two smaller 100-foot and 85-foot versions of the yacht.
